Councilmember Vincent B. Orange, Sr. A BILL IN THE COUNCIL OF THE DISTRICT OF COLUMBIA Councilmember Vincent Orange introduced the following bill, which was referred to the Committee on Finance and Revenue. To amend Title 47 of the District of Columbia Code to provide an increased real property tax reduction to senior citizen homeowners with household adjusted gross incomes of $30,000 or less. BE IT ENACTED BY THE COUNCIL OF THE DISTRICT OF COLUMBIA, That this act may be cited as the "Senior Citizen Real Property Tax Reduction Act of 2000". Sec. 2. Real Property Tax. Section 47-863(b) of the District of Columbia Code is amended as follows: (a) By designating the existing language as paragraph (1); and, (b) By adding a new paragraph (2) at the end thereof to read as follows:
Sec. 3. Fiscal Impact. The Council adopts the fiscal impact statement in the Committee Report as the fiscal impact statement required by section 602(c)(3) of the District of Columbia Home Rule Act, approved December 24, 1973 (87 Stat. 813; D.C. Code, sec. 1-233(c)(3)). Sec. 4. Effective Date. This act shall take effect upon its enactment (approval by the Mayor, or in the event of veto by the Mayor, override of the veto by the Council), and approval by the Financial Responsibility and Management Assistance Authority as provided in section 203(a) of the District of Columbia Financial Responsibility and Management Assistance Act of 1995, approved April 17, 1995 (109 Stat. 116; D.C. Code, sec. 47-392.3(a)), a 30-day period of Congressional review as provided in section 602(c)(2) of the District of Columbia Self-Government and Governmental Responsibility Act, approved December 24, 1973 (87 Stat. 813; D.C. Code, sec. 1-233(c)(2)), and publication in the District of Columbia Register. |
